Heavy rain over the weekend has led to this week’s Second XI Championship match with Lancashire at Caythorpe CC been abandoned without a ball bowled.The game was due to start today but after an inspection it was decided no play would be possible due to saturation of the pitch.Said Second XI coach Wayne Noon: “The rain at the weekend left the whole pitch like a bog. Water had also got under the covers and left the wicket very muddy as well.“There was no chance of getting any cricket in so to be fair to Lancashire we’ve told them not to make the trip."We’ve looked at re-arranging the game for later in the season but there doesn’t seem to be a free week where both teams are able to play.“It’s unfortunate but these things happen and you can only blame the weather.”
